Tag: JavaScript
-
CSS Modules をもっと試す
業務プロジェクトへ CSS Modules 導入を検討中。しかし JS/CSS ともに大きく設計変更されるため、いきなり採用するのは怖い。というわけで、そこそこの規模と複雑さを持つ examples-electron/audio-player で試してみた。
-
gulp で uglify-es を利用する
タスク ランナーは npm-scripts 派なのだけど akabekobeko/examples-web-app に公開している front-end-starter には gulp 版も用意してある...
-
npm 開発で再び Babel を導入することにした
以前、npm 開発で脱 Babel してみるという記事を書いた。そして二ヶ月ほど特に問題なく運用できていたのだが、babel-preset-env を試してみたら考えが変わった。脱 Babel を決...
-
babel-preset-babili を試す
babel-preset-env と minify の続き。前回は ES.next なコードを minify する方法として uglify-js を中心に babel-preset-babili を...
-
babel-preset-env と minify
babel-preset-env を試す で試した Electron 用の設定を実際に akabekobeko/examples-electron へ適用してみたところ、いろいろと問題があったので記...
-
babel-preset-env を試す
npm として配布するものは純粋な Node 機能のみで構成したいため脱 Babelしたが、Web フロントエンドや Electron では最新の ECMAScript 機能を利用したい。というわけ...
-
JavaScript Standard Style を試す
話題の JavaScript Standard Style を試してみた。以前、以下の記事とはてブで JavaScript Standard Style を知った。はてブではセミコロンの省略に抵抗感...
-
ESDoc の設定を package.json に定義する
これまで ESDoc の設定は `esdoc.json` に定義していたが昨年末にリリースされた v0.5.0 から他の形式もサポートされるようになった。CHANGELOG.md にはとある。これら...
-
npm-scripts で Web フロントエンド開発を管理する
gulp なしの Web フロントエンド開発から 1 年あまり。その間、特に問題もなく npm-scripts で Web フロントエンド開発を管理できているので、この間に得られた運用知見や所感など...
-
npm_package_config と npm_config
npm-run-all の Support npm config params という issue から `npm_config` の存在を知った。以前 npm-scripts 内で変数を展開したく...